Who we are: Aerzen USA Corp. is an international manufacturer of positive displacement blowers, hybrid blowers, screw compressors and turbo blowers. These high-quality machines are used for air and gas applications across many essential industries, including; Wastewater, Cement, Biogas, Pharmaceutical and Food, among many others.
